SUBJECT CODE : DES1203
SUBJECT NAME : INFORMATION & COMMUNICATION TECHNOLOGY
SEMESTER : 2
CREDIT HOURS : 4
SCHOOL : School of Secretarial Studies
COURSE : Diploma / Diploma in Executive Secretaryship

OBJECTIVES

The objectives of this unit are:

  • Enable the student to understand the general principles and procedures for using the computer
  • Enable the student to operate the basic features of the MS Word, MS Excel, MS Outlook, MS PowerPoint and MS Access programmes, in order to produce business documents.

LEARNING OUTCOME

Upon completion of this unit, students will be able to:

  • Understand the general principles and procedures for using the computer.
  • Be able to manage files safely and effectively.
  • Be able to operate the basic features of the MS Word, MS Excel, MS Outlook, MS PowerPoint and MS Access programs in order to produce business documents.

SYNOPSIS

Unit 1 - MS Word

  • Basic application of MS Word

Unit 2 - MS PowerPoint

  • Preparing slide presentations
  • Preparing organisation charts

Unit 3 - MS Excel

  • Simple calculation
  • Graph /chart
  • Formulas
  • Presentation of data / display forms

Unit 4 - MS Access

  • Organise electronic data storage system
  • Preparing report and query

Unit 5 - MS Outlook

  • Organise address book
  • Set and display appointment

Unit 6 - Internet

  • Search Information
  • Select and import information / graphic from internet

Unit 7 - Email

  • Sending email
  • Basic function under email
